How to Read the Engagement Characterization on an Egg Carton
The USDA requires that all nutrient companies create accurate labels and claims on food cartons. Egg cartons may include a Julian date or pack-date on the label to tell you exactly when the carton was created. To read a Julian date, you need to know that January 1st is read as 001, and December 31st is read as 365 (unless it's a leap year, in which example it will exist 366). As you can see, the number indicates the day of the year the egg carton was packaged. You should employ this appointment to make up one's mind a starting point to measure the freshness of the egg rather than the sell-by date on the packet, which only indicates the bespeak at which the store should no longer stock the eggs on its shelves.
West hen Practise Eggs Actually Expire?
Eggs practice not necessarily expire on the sell-by engagement. In fact, eggs are typically good to eat for virtually three to v weeks after the engagement on the carton. Egg cartons typically list an expiration appointment that's nearly thirty days from the packaging date, and you should e'er purchase eggs earlier this date. If yous continue the eggs in their original carton and air-condition them in the coldest part of your refrigerator, they should remain safe and delicious to eat for weeks. Brand sure you don't refrigerate eggs in the door, as this part of the apparatus is not consistently cold. As you can encounter, you don't have to throw away the eggs when you lot notice the sell-by or expiration date has passed.
H ow to Tell Eggs Are Still Good
One of the easiest ways to determine if eggs are still good is to grab a glass or basin of water. Place the egg you lot want to test in the water and observe its movements. If the egg quickly floats to the top of the water, it's gone bad. If the egg drops to the bottom, you tin can feel safe eating it.
Bad eggs float because they've accumulated a multitude of gases within the shell. The air inside the egg has grown enough that the egg has buoyancy. Good eggs don't take these gases, so they sink.
Keep in mind that even if an egg does float, it may not necessarily be unsafe to eat. You can crack the egg into a bowl and scent it to determine if the egg may still be adept to eat. Never eat an egg that smells bad or rotten.
C ook Eggs Thoroughly
Eating iffy eggs? Make sure to melt them thoroughly to ensure you do not go sick. Fifty-fifty if y'all cook eggs that yous know to be good, they should exist cooked through. A thoroughly cooked egg is i in which the egg yolks and whites are house rather than runny. If yous were to stick a thermometer in the egg, it should read 160 degrees Fahrenheit.
Eastward gg Expiration After Cooking
So, what happens after you cook the eggs? If you hard-boil eggs, you should make certain to refrigerate them inside 2 hours of cooking and then exist sure to eat them within the span of a week. Practise not put them back into their original carton for refrigeration. If yous cook other types of eggs, like scrambled or fried eggs, use them within virtually four days for best results.y
If you have frozen eggs, don't keep them for longer than one year, and never store eggs frozen within their shells. Rather, vanquish the eggs and yolks together and store them in the freezer.
